The Fascist Rejection of Socialism
This chapter explores the fundamental beliefs of fascist ideology, highlighting its fierce opposition to socialism and communism as perceived threats to national integrity. It examines historical instances of fascist movements in Italy and Germany, their anti-Semitic attitudes, and their rise to power through democratic means amidst political unrest.
